ESPN Player Evaluations
Deep South-April 10: A forward with a very good all-around game.Can do everything well. Appeared to be closer to 6-1 then her reported 6-2 height.
Derby Classic-July 09: Illinois Dream Team wing Whitney Adams is a workhorse on the court. She really does a little of everything and she does it well. Her versatility is what makes her such an effective player because at 6-foot and with a strong build she can play the wing or the forward position. From the high post she creates with the pass, can put it on the ground or knock down the open shot. From the wing she is deceptively quick and gives you another rebounding force from the 3 position. She makes an impact whether she gets touches or not.
Midwest Showdown-May 09: have to watch a couple of times to appreciate everything they do and the Illinois Lady Broncos' Whitney Adams does a lot of things on the court. The 6-1 forward is a glue player. She makes plays when they are there and plays her role on the floor. That's not to say she's passive because she is one of the more active players on the floor. She does a little bit of everything and does most of it very well. She is most effective offensively at the high post because she can face up, attack off the dribble, hit the shot or place a perfect pass on the post duck-in. She's a hardworking kid who gets the most out of her athletic ability.
